Game Day Smoker Recipes: 7 Irresistible Wings to Try


  • Author: Julia marin
  • Total Time: 2 hours 15 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x
  • Diet: Gluten Free

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 lbs of chicken wings
  • 1/4 cup of olive oil
  • 2 tbsp of smoked paprika
  • 1 tbsp of garlic powder
  • 1 tbsp of onion powder
  • 1 tsp of salt
  • 1 tsp of black pepper
  • 1/2 cup of barbecue sauce

Instructions

  1. Preheat your smoker to 225°F.
  2. In a large bowl, combine olive oil, smoked paprika, garlic powder, onion powder, salt, and black pepper.
  3. Add chicken wings to the bowl and toss to coat evenly.
  4. Place wings on the smoker rack.
  5. Smoke for 1.5 to 2 hours, or until the internal temperature reaches 165°F.
  6. During the last 30 minutes, brush wings with barbecue sauce.
  7. Remove wings from the smoker and let them rest for 5 minutes before serving.

Notes

  • Adjust spice levels to your taste.
  • Use different sauces for variety.
  • Pair with your favorite dips.
